Institute of Documentary Film’s Activities
Founded in 2001, the INSTITUTE OF DOCUMENTARY FILM (IDF) is a non-profit training and networking centre based in Prague, Czech Republic, focused on the support of East European documentary films and their wider promotion. Our activities support filmmakers through all stages of completion – development, funding, production, post-production, and distribution. We aim at individual filmmakers (tailored consultations), groups of carefully selected professionals with projects or films (Ex Oriente Film, East European Forum, East Silver, Doc Launch, etc.), broader professional community (East Doc Platform), as well as the general public (portal www.DOKweb.net). We closely work with key int. festivals, broadcasters, distributors, sales agents, markets, or training initiatives and serve as the GATEWAY TO EAST EUROPEAN DOCUMENTARY FILM.

Pitch.DOC Georgia Open for Projects

The 2nd Pitch.Doc - a documentary pitching session in Georgia - will host filmmakers and funders December 8 - 11, 2010 at the 11th Tbilisi International Film Festival. Documentary projects in development from Armenia, Azerbaijan, Bulgaria, Georgia, Romania, Russia, Turkey and Ukraine can be submitted until September 24, 2010.

PITCH.DOC GEORGIA 2010
December 8 - 11, 2010
Tbilisi / Georgia
Application Deadline: September 24, 2010



The second edition of the documentary film pitching session in Georgia – Pitch.Doc – will take place December 8 - 11, 2010 at the 11th Tbilisi International Film festival (TIFF). The Pitching Session is open for documentary film projects in development from the following countries: Georgia, Armenia, Azerbaijan, Ukraine, Romania, Bulgaria, Turkey, Russia.


Conditions: Participation is open for the directors or producers having full length documentary film project in development. The event will include a two-day training (panel discussions, workshops). Participants will pitch their project to a qualified commission consisting of at least 10 members (including festival participants) - film directors, producers, representatives of international funds, production companies, commissioning editors etc. Pitching session will be hosted by an experienced moderator.


Participation Fee: Participation is free of charge. Organizers will cover travel, accommodation, coffee breaks and lunches of selected participants.
